Step 1: Mount the Neco Garage Door Controller
The first step is to mount the Neco garage door controller near your garage door opener Make sure the controller is securely attached to the wall and within reach of the garage door opener Use the screws provided in the kit to mount the controller.
Step 2: Connect the Wires
Next, you will need to connect the wires from the Neco garage door controller to the garage door opener Consult the instruction manual that came with the kit for detailed wiring diagrams Make sure to follow the color-coded instructions to ensure the wires are connected correctly.
Step 3: Pair the Remote Control
Once the controller is mounted and the wires are connected, it’s time to pair the remote control Press the program button on the Neco garage door controller and then press the button on the remote control that you want to pair neco garage door controller instructions. The lights on the controller should flash to indicate that the pairing was successful.
Step 4: Program the Controller
Now that the remote control is paired, you can start programming the controller Press the program button on the Neco garage door controller and follow the on-screen instructions to set up your desired preferences, such as opening and closing speed, sensitivity, and auto-lock features.
Step 5: Testing
After you have programmed the controller, it’s time to test the functionality Use the remote control to open and close the garage door to ensure everything is working properly Make any necessary adjustments to the settings if needed.
